Or will we have to sit through advertisements like we do on Amazon Prime now? Thanks for any information. It's still a pending sale, as it requires regulatory approval. Even if the sale does go through, the ownership of the "classic" MGM films will not change. There's a lot of misinformation regarding the "MGM vault" in the press. Warner Bros owns the rights to MGM properties made before May 1986. WB got them because Ted Turner bought the rights when he briefly owned MGM in 1986. He sold the production portion of MGM/UA, but retained the film rights.
